피드로 돌아가기
GeekNewsDevOps
원문 읽기
Show GN: set-prompt git레포 기반 프롬프트 저장소 AI에이전트 연결
Git 저장소 기반 Symbolic Link 설계를 통한 AI 프롬프트 통합 관리 체계 구축
AI 요약
Context
Claude Code, OpenClaw, RooCode 등 다수 AI 도구 사용에 따른 프롬프트 파편화 발생. 도구별 개별 수정으로 인한 버전 불일치 및 관리 공수 증가라는 운영 효율성 저하 문제 직면.
Technical Solution
- Git 저장소를 Single Source of Truth로 정의한 프롬프트 중앙 관리 구조 설계
- 파일 시스템 수준의 Symbolic Link를 활용한 AI 도구 설정 경로와 Git 레포지토리 간의 실시간 동기화 구현
- 다수 도구의 설정 위치를 추상화하여 단일 저장소 업데이트만으로 전 도구에 즉시 반영하는 배포 프로세스 구축
- 기존 설정 데이터 손실 방지를 위한 자동 백업 로직 구현 및 사용자 수동 백업 권장 프로세스 도입
- npm 패키지화를 통한 설치 및 설정 자동화 도구 제공
실천 포인트
1. 다수 서비스 간 설정 동기화 필요 시 Symbolic Link를 통한 파일 시스템 레벨의 통합 검토
2. 설정 데이터의 Single Source of Truth를 Git 저장소로 일원화하여 버전 관리 및 변경 이력 추적 확보
3. 시스템 설정 변경 도구 설계 시 예외 상황에 대비한 백업 및 복구 전략 우선 수립